Is it possible to use Flex Builder for coding? Hey guys, since Flex 2 was released, I moved to FB and never looked back. But the current project i'm working on involves 70% design and 30% coding. It seemed more appropriate to me to use Flash CS3 for this project, but then i realized that the code panel still sucks. It seems illogical to me not having some tools essential to developers on Flash CS3 code panel. Is there a solution, a plugin, or some technique to improve the development in Flash CS3? Before Flex 2, i was adept of using osflash tools to improve my development. I used Flash 8 to create the interface and some of the animations, and ASDT on Eclipse with MTASC to create and inject the code on the SWF. Can i achieve a similar workflow with Flash CS3 and Flex 2? Note: I know i can create SWC components in Flash CS3, and import them on Flex, and it works perfectly when we are building a Flex project that needs some crazy-looking components. But in this cas, i am creating the project on Flash CS3, and i need the coding tools of Flex to improve my workflow... Any suggestions?
